• Son of the Rev. John Hutcheon, minister of Fetteresso, and Mary Morison.
  • Educated at King’s College
  • Apprenticed to Arthur Dingwall Fordyce 
  • Sometime in partnership with Francis Edmond, firm being Hutcheon & Edmond.
  • Procurator Fiscal of Commissary Court.
  • Clerk to the Commissioners for Redemption of Land Tax.
  • 1801  Joint Clerk and Assessor to the Incorporated Trades of Aberdeen.
  • Treasurer and legal adviser to, and honorary member of, the Medico-Chirurgical Society, Aberdeen.
  • J.P. for Aberdeenshire.
  • 1806 – Fiars Juror.
  • 1806-08 – Treasurer of the Society of Advocates
  • 1816-18 – President of the Society of Advocates
  • 1832 – Died, unmarried, 10th December,  aged 67
